About This Item

Boston: Little, Brown and Co, 1913. Revised and Enlarged Edition. Hardcover. Good (Boards are edgeworn/scuffed/smudged/discolored; textblock edges are toned/scuffed/smudged; front pastedown has a personal stamp and a mounted poem; ffep has a personal stamp and an illustrative sticker; textblock is cracked; spine is a little wobbly; interior is clean with some light toning.). Light blue boards with brown and peach-coloured lettering and illustration; xxiv, 352 pp.; frontispiece, illustrations, one folded plate. Contents include: The Colorado River and its canyons -- Explorations from the time of the Spaniards (1540) to Major J.W. Powell (1869) -- Explorations by Major J.W. Powell (1869-72) -- Later explorations -- Flagstaff, the San Francisco Mountains, the cliff and cave dwellings, and the dead volcanoes -- From the Santa Fe Railway to the canyon by stage -- The Grand Canyon Railway and El Tovar Hotel -- First impressions -- What does one see? -- On the rim -- The Grand View trail -- The Bright Angel Trail -- Two days' hunt for a boat in a side gorge near the Bright Angel Trail -- The Mystic Spring Trail -- Three days of exploring in Trail Canyon with the wrong companion -- Mr. W.W. Bass and his canyon experiences -- The Shinumo and its ancient inhabitants -- Peach Springs Trail -- Lee's Ferry and the journey thither -- John D. Lee and the Mountain Meadows Massacre -- Up and down Glen and Marble Canyons -- The old Hopi Salt Trail -- The Tanner-French Trail -- The Red Canyon and old trails -- Grand Canyon Forest Reserve -- The Topocobya Trail and Havasu (Cataract) Canyon -- The Havasupai Indians and their canyon home -- Havasu (Cataract) Canyon and its waterfalls and limestone caves -- An adventure in Beaver Canyon -- The geology of the Grand Canyon -- Botany of the Grand Canyon -- Religious and other impressions in the Grand Canyon -- Photographing the Grand Canyon.
